2008 Community Service Award for Greek Life Recipient Lambda Chi Alpha Fraternity
|
|
 |
In a tribute to outstanding commitment to community service, the Rensselaer Alumni Association recognized Lambda Chi Alpha fraternity with its Community Service Award for Greek Life at center ice during the first intermission of the RPI vs. UMASS men's hockey game on October 21, during Greek Night. Historic Rensselaer Capital Campaign Reaches Goal Nine Months Ahead of Schedule |
 |
 |
|
 |
Rensselaer announced on October 1 that it had surpassed the $1.4 billion Renaissance at Rensselaer capital campaign goal. |
The announcement comes nine months in advance of the campaign’s target end date of June 30, 2009, and just days before the opening of the new Experimental Media and Performing Arts Center (EMPAC), launched under President Shirley Ann Jackson’s ambitious Rensselaer Plan. Robert Schlesinger Named New Head of Institute Advancement |
 |
|
| Robert Schlesinger, an experienced professional in university development and alumni relations, has joined Rensselaer as vice president for institute advancement. Schlesinger will lead efforts to coordinate, plan, and implement fundraising and relationship-building programs with students, faculty, alumni, parents, friends, corporations, and foundations.
